I’ve been using KD V2 drivers for the P60 drop-ins I’ve been making lately with good results. I completed another one yesterday and am puzzled by one of the modes.

The first couple of drop-ins are 3-up XP-Gs with V2s set for three modes (low-med-high) and memory. Both have 4 additional 380ma 7135s. Both of those drivers show the following, 0.10a low, 0.92a med and 4.40a high.
I also built a single XM-L using the same driver with 2 additional 7135s which measures 0.10a low, 0.93a med and 3.70a high.

Those all seem fine. I had to order more drivers and chips after cooking a few along the way. Yesterday I put together a 3-up XP-G2 with one of the new V2s adding 6 extra 7135s, the result, 0.01a low, 1.00a med and 5.20a high.

What I don’t understand is the 0.01a low, it’s actually less light the my E-1320 XM-Ls on moonlight mode.

Did I damage something adding the 7135s? I figured I was ok when the high mode showed the expected amperage. Have the drivers changed? I have four more drivers but haven’t done anything with them yet.

0.01a is really unusable, I may just change the modes to high, med, 1.0a is plenty for most use and 5+a is fine for wow factor.

Maybe it is because of the parasitic capacitance on each emitter add up and act as a low pass filter. A very low duty cycle is used for the low low which means very short pulses of on and off switching. More capacitor on the load just softens these sharp pulses and cut them short for the smallest ones.

I think you’ll need 50mA low versions of these V2 drivers.

Edit again: I just went back to KD, I now see what you were saying. They sell two versions, one with a 50ma low and one with a 3-5ma low. I must have purchased the 50ma low drivers the first time around and the 3-5ma the second time. The first three lights were built with my first batch of drivers. WHAT A DOPE!!!
